SUMMARY

The Corporate Development Data Analyst will support senior management of the portfolio along with the Corporate
Development leadership. Primary responsibilities of the team includes, but is not limited to, dashboard development and maintenance, report generation, forecasting future events using statistical methods, and optimizing supply chain networks.
The Analyst will work closely with senior management across portfolio companies and corporate management, interfacing daily with CFO, COO, and various division heads. The Analyst will become an expert on all data leveraged by all facets of the company.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
  • Reporting and analysis across multiple portfolio companies on finances, operations, sales, etc
  • Direct, consolidate, and administer annual budget preparation and in-year forecasting for portfolio companies.
  • Analyze monthly, quarterly, and annual financials, including KPI’s, compared to forecast, budget, and prior year.
  • Perform complex ad-hoc analyses to assist in execution of existing and formulation of new business strategies in concert with portfolio level and corporate management teams.
  • Develop new approaches, processes, or methods to solve business problems, act as an agent of change; continuous reevaluation of process to achieve operational and financial goals always utilizing data.
  • Develop dashboards in Qlik Sense to support business operations.
  • Assist sales organizations in analyzing commodity markets to support large contract bids (RFP/Q’s)
  • Drive various technology roll outs across companies and departments.
  • Ongoing, general portfolio management
